Can anyone help me in explaining subtraction of polynomials please help I’m desperate and I’m pretty much on my own when it come
Sidana [21]

Answer:

Think of combining <u>like terms</u> when subtracting polynomials. For example, 3x² and -2x². They both have x² in common. So, if you were to combine 3x² and -2x², it would be like 3x² + (-2x²). Think of this like 3 + (-2), which equals 1. In this case, it would equal 1x² or x².

Let's take this problem for example: 6x² - 3x + 4 - (-2x² +2x - 2)

Parentheses are super important; The first thing you want to do is distribute the negative sign out to everything inside the parentheses!

So,

6x² - 3x + 4 - (-2x² +2x - 2) *multiply the neg. to -2x², 2x, and -2

Now, if you do that, the equation would now look like:

6x² - 3x + 4 + 2x² - 2x + 2

Now think of combining like terms. Here are the like terms:

6x² <em>- 3x</em> <u>+ 4</u> + 2x² <em>- 2x</em> <u>+ 2</u> (Let's rewrite it to look like this...)

6x² + 2x² <em>- 3x</em> <em>- 2x </em><u>+ 4</u> <u>+ 2</u>

Let's combine the x²'s first, so... 6x² + 2x² = 8x²

Let's combine the x's, so...<em> -3x - 2x = -5x</em>

Let's combine the constants (numbers with no variable), so... <u>4 + 2 = 6</u>

<u />

Your solution should be 8x² - 5x + 6
